ALERT: DeployBot unresponsive. The Glimmerline chat bot stopped posting deploy status to the #releases channel at 14:02 UTC. Deploys may still be running; verify via the Cartwheel pipeline dashboard before assuming failure. Restart the bot pod in the ops-tools namespace first. If it crashes again within ten minutes, page the Tooling rotation. For escalation beyond that, send details to the address below.

escalation mailbox, bafog-fafog: ulador@paliqlabs.internal

Quick context before the Myrridge cut: the autocomplete index has been slow because we rebuild the full trie on every publish, even for one-character dictionary edits. The fix in this release switches to incremental segment merges, which drops rebuild time from minutes to seconds in staging. It's safe to ship, but the merge behavior is sensitive to a few knobs — too aggressive and we thrash disk, too lazy and queries degrade. We've settled on conservative defaults after a week of load tests, listed here.

limits module of tafop-hahop:
WEIGHTS = {
    "julmir": 223,
    "belox": 987,
    "lamion": 470,
    "pelath": 609,
    "fraok": 1010,
    "eliion": 343,
    "drudor": 342,
}

Quarterly Planning Note — Capacity Decision

Heads of department: the Brennick plant is at 94% utilisation. Options reviewed: second shift, line automation, or shifting Corvette-series output to the Maulden site. Recommendation is the second shift from next quarter, with automation deferred pending the Fentress study. Capex request goes to the board in three weeks. Hold hiring plans until then. The confidential direction below explains why.

confidential, fahip-bagep: The southern region missed its Holwyn quota by 21.5 percent last quarter. Sorvanek Foods plans to raise the Jorir list price by 23.9 percent in December. The pricing group signed off on a budget of $411.6 million for Project Eliion. The renewal with Juldorix Works closes at $87.9 million a year, 16.8 percent below the last contract.